Description
Tenda AX1803 v1.0.0.1 contains a stack overflow via the adv.iptv.stbpvid parameter in the function getIptvInfo.
Comprehensive Technical Analysis of CVE-2023-51971
1. Vulnerability Assessment and Severity Evaluation
CVE ID: CVE-2023-51971
Description: Tenda AX1803 v1.0.0.1 contains a stack overflow via the adv.iptv.stbpvid parameter in the function getIptvInfo.
CVSS Score: 9.8
Severity Evaluation: The CVSS score of 9.8 indicates a critical vulnerability. This high score is likely due to the potential for remote code execution, which can lead to complete system compromise. The stack overflow vulnerability can be exploited to execute arbitrary code, leading to significant security risks.
2. Potential Attack Vectors and Exploitation Methods
Attack Vectors:
- Remote Exploitation: An attacker can send a specially crafted request to the
getIptvInfofunction with a maliciousadv.iptv.stbpvidparameter, causing a stack overflow. - Network-Based Attacks: Given that the Tenda AX1803 is a network device, attackers can exploit this vulnerability over the network, making it accessible to a wide range of potential attackers.
Exploitation Methods:
- Buffer Overflow: By sending a large amount of data to the
adv.iptv.stbpvidparameter, an attacker can overwrite the stack, leading to arbitrary code execution. - Payload Delivery: The attacker can inject malicious code into the stack, which can then be executed, allowing for further exploitation of the device.
